Henry, who had a successful spell at FC Barcelona, was candid about the club’s current attacking options, insisting that the Catalan side lacks a proven, ruthless striker capable of finishing chances created by their emerging talents.

Speaking to Sport, the Frenchman said, “Barcelona need a real number 9. A top-level striker. I am referring to formidable scorers such as Victor Osimhen, Erling Haaland, or Harry Kane. Proven finishers, not prospects.”

By naming Osimhen alongside the likes of Haaland and Kane, Henry placed the Nigerian forward among Europe’s most feared attackers. He also criticized Barcelona’s ongoing struggles with chance conversion, pointing out how costly missed opportunities can be. Referring to teenage sensation Lamine Yamal, Henry added, “When you have a talent like Lamine Yamal, who delivers passes like that, you have to score. It’s simple. At this level, one chance is enough. I’ve seen games where too many chances were wasted. At Barcelona, that can’t happen. That’s what separates being competitive from being a champion.”

Meanwhile, Osimhen will miss Galatasaray’s league clash against Konyaspor this weekend. The Turkish club confirmed he was left out of the squad as a precaution due to discomfort in his right knee.

In a statement, Galatasaray said, “Victor Osimhen, who is complaining of pain in his right knee, has been withheld from the squad for the match against Konyaspor as a precaution.”

There are no major concerns about his fitness. The move is aimed at ensuring he is fully ready for the crucial UEFA Champions League play-off second leg against Juventus in Turin. Galatasaray hold a 5-2 lead from the first leg, in which Osimhen contributed two assists.

Domestically, the 27-year-old has been pivotal in Galatasaray’s Süper Lig title chase, scoring nine goals and providing three assists as the club sits three points clear at the top with 55 points.

The association, through its media office in Abuja, clarified that it did not issue any invitation to the Sultan, stressing that the information being circulated did not originate from CAN and should not be associated with the body.

CAN explained that the document causing the confusion was issued by the Office of the Secretary to the Government of the Federation (SGF), adding that it never approved or circulated any communication involving the Sultan in the chapel project.

It said the clarification became necessary to correct the public impression and prevent misinformation linking it to the claim.

In his place, the association’s former 1st Vice-Chairman, Temidire Ewonowo, has been appointed as the new chairman in line with the NMA constitution.

The decision was taken through a secret ballot after members accused the former chairman of repeatedly violating the association’s rules and regulations.

Addressing the development, Ewonowo listed several allegations against Saheed, including failure to convene an Emergency General Meeting within the stipulated time after a formal request was made by affiliate leaders and members.

He also cited instances where the former chairman allegedly walked out of a duly convened Emergency General Meeting and submitted an unapproved delegate list.

According to him, the chairman also referred members to a disciplinary committee based on decisions that were not approved by the State Executive Council or congress.

Ewonowo said the constitution provides that in the event of a chairman’s removal, the 1st Vice-Chairman automatically assumes leadership, adding that due process was followed.

He noted that the meeting had 112 members and nine affiliate heads in attendance, meeting the required quorum for such a decision.

Out of the votes cast, 93 supported the removal, four opposed it, while three were invalid.

He further stated that the Emergency General Meeting remains the highest decision-making body of the association.
